The ISA Sound, Evolved
The ISA story starts in 1985 with a request from Sir George Martin: build a no-compromise mic preamp. That circuit became the foundation of every ISA product made since. 40 years on, it lives in ISA C8X — Focusrite's first ISA audio interface, housed in anodised aluminium in Focusrite's original blue colour, with heritage transformer sound in a 26-in, 28-out USB-C interface built for the modern studio.
Heritage Sound With Total Control
The two ISA preamps at the heart of ISA C8X feature the same Lundahl LL1538 transformers chosen in 1985. Warm, rich, and detailed on any source, with up to 79dB of gain, switchable impedance, and balanced inserts — and for the first time in ISA’s storied history, remotely controllable via Focusrite Control 2.
All-Analog Tone
ISA gives you two relay-switchable analog circuits. Console mode introduces warm saturation and low-end punch via a variable soft-clip circuit. 430 Air, lifted directly from the ISA 430 MkII, adds high-end shimmer through an inductor-based high-shelf filter. Both are completely analog with full-bodied sound.
